XCEL ENERGY INC Quarterly Report for Q1 Ended Mar 31, 2026
Apr 30, 2026Xcel Energy Inc. (XEL) reported solid financial performance for the first quarter of 2026, with net income increasing to $556 million, or $0.89 per diluted share, compared to $483 million, or $0.84 per diluted share, in the same period of 2025. This growth was driven by higher electric revenues from infrastructure investments and sales growth, partially offset by increased financing costs and depreciation. The company also benefited from positive regulatory outcomes and continued investment in its utility infrastructure across its service territories. The company's operational strength is underpinned by significant capital expenditures, with $3.02 billion used in investing activities during the quarter, primarily focused on system improvements and renewable energy projects. Xcel Energy also demonstrated strong cash flow generation from operations, totaling $1.7 billion, which, along with successful debt issuances, has bolstered its financial flexibility to support ongoing capital programs. While facing challenges like wildfire litigation and regulatory proceedings, Xcel Energy's proactive management and regulatory strategies position it to navigate these complexities and maintain its long-term growth objectives.

XCEL ENERGY INC Quarterly Report for Q2 Ended Jun 30, 2019
Aug 1, 2019Xcel Energy Inc. (XEL) reported its second-quarter and year-to-date financial results for the period ending June 30, 2019. For the second quarter, the company's diluted earnings per share (EPS) were $0.46, a decrease from $0.52 in the same period of the prior year. Year-to-date, diluted EPS stood at $1.07, also a decrease from $1.09 for the first six months of 2018. While total operating revenues saw a slight increase for the six-month period ($5.718 billion in 2019 vs. $5.609 billion in 2018), net income saw a modest decline to $553 million from $556 million year-to-date. The company's financial performance was impacted by a combination of factors including higher electric and natural gas margins, driven by non-fuel riders and regulatory rate outcomes, which were more than offset by unfavorable weather, increased depreciation, interest, and operating and maintenance expenses. The company highlighted its ongoing regulatory proceedings and strategic initiatives. Notably, NSP-Wisconsin reached a settlement for its 2020-2021 rate case, resulting in no change to electric base rates and a decrease in natural gas base rates. PSCo filed for a net rate increase of approximately $158 million for its electric utility, and SPS filed for an increase of approximately $51 million for its electric utility. Xcel Energy continues to focus on its long-term objectives, including delivering annual EPS growth of 5-7% and annual dividend increases of 5-7%, while maintaining strong credit ratings.

XCEL ENERGY INC Quarterly Report for Q1 Ended Mar 31, 2015
May 1, 2015Xcel Energy Inc. reported a net income of $152.1 million for the first quarter of 2015, a decrease from $261.2 million in the same period of the prior year. This decline was primarily driven by lower operating revenues, particularly in natural gas, and a significant $129.5 million pre-tax charge related to the Monticello life cycle management/extended power uprate project. Despite the lower net income, the company's ongoing earnings (excluding the Monticello charge) were $0.46 per share, down from $0.52 in the prior year, mainly due to less favorable weather conditions compared to the unusually cold first quarter of 2014. The company continued to invest in utility capital expenditures and maintained a strong liquidity position with available credit facilities. Regulatory proceedings remain a key focus, with significant developments in rate cases across various jurisdictions, including a recent approved rate increase for NSP-Minnesota and a settlement for PSCo's electric rate case. The company also provided an updated 2015 ongoing earnings guidance of $2.00 to $2.15 per share, reflecting its outlook for the remainder of the year, assuming normal weather patterns and constructive regulatory outcomes. Xcel Energy remains committed to its long-term objectives of EPS growth and dividend increases, supported by ongoing investments in its regulated utility assets.

XCEL ENERGY INC Quarterly Report for Q3 Ended Sep 30, 2010
Oct 29, 2010Xcel Energy Inc. reported solid financial results for the nine months ended September 30, 2010, with net income increasing to $619.2 million, or $1.34 per diluted share, from $512.0 million, or $1.11 per diluted share, in the same period of 2009. This growth was driven primarily by higher operating revenues, particularly in the electric segment, and the positive impact of warmer temperatures leading to increased electric sales. The company also benefited from rate increases across its service territories and a one-time $25 million settlement related to a discontinued Corporate Owned Life Insurance (COLI) program. Despite the overall positive performance, investors should note certain non-recurring items that impacted reported earnings. These include a tax expense related to the Patient Protection and Affordable Care Act and charges related to the COLI program's tax and interest reconciliation. The company has also provided earnings guidance for the remainder of 2010 and 2011, indicating expected continued growth, driven by operational efficiencies, regulatory approvals, and ongoing investments in infrastructure.
